How is the Iliohypogastric Nerve Block Performed?

The procedure is typically performed under ultrasound guidance to ensure precise placement of the needle. The patient is usually positioned in a supine or lateral position. After identifying the anatomical landmarks, the physician will clean the area with an antiseptic solution and inject a local anesthetic to numb the skin. A needle is then inserted near the iliac crest, and the anesthetic is administered around the iliohypogastric nerve.
